As normalcy gradually returns to Kano following the conclusion of the #EndBadGovernance protests, the State Government has lifted the curfew it imposed on the city.

Violence rocked Kano during the protests, with property worth billions of naira destroyed and looted by irate mobs.

The government slammed a 24 hours curfew on the city as a result of the development, and later reduced it to 6:00 am to 6:00 pm to allow opportunity for business activities.

In a statement on the Facebook page of Governor Abba Kabir Yusuf on Monday, his media Aide, Salisu Yahya Hotoro, announced that the State Government is convinced that peace has returned to the city, necessitating the need to lift the curfew.

“The 24 hours curfew slammed on Kano, has been effectively lifted as peace has completely returned to the city,” the statement declared
